今年早些时候,AWS 实现了一项功能,您可以通过元数据 url 检索实例标签,这非常棒,只是您需要为每个实例打开它......我在不同区域拥有 20 多个账户,其中包含数百个 EC2每个帐户内。最简单的方法是什么?
您可以有一个运行类似以下内容的 ansible/bash 脚本:
---
- name: Get instance_id
import_role:
name: common
tasks_from: instance_id.yml
- name: Enable IMDS tags
shell: |
aws ec2 modify-instance-metadata-options \
--instance-id {{ instance_id }} \
--instance-metadata-tags enabled